    Marshall's is as close to fabric heaven as it gets. I love it. I live about 3½ hours from there, drive down to Branson, pick my 2 quilting buddies up and away we go. If you have a tax number you can buy wholesale. They have everything. I bought from then on-line for about a year and then we made a road-trip. They have great prices inside their store. They carry 60" wide broadcloth, 108" backing, there isn't too much they don't have. The customer service there is wonderful.
